[发明专利]一种支付标记化应用的测试系统及方法在审
申请号: | 202010343596.0 | 申请日: | 2020-04-27 |
公开(公告)号: | CN111538664A | 公开(公告)日: | 2020-08-14 |
发明(设计)人: | 李宁馨;佘锐 | 申请(专利权)人: | 中国银行股份有限公司 |
主分类号: | G06F11/36 | 分类号: | G06F11/36 |
代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 钱湾湾 |
地址: | 100818 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 支付 标记 应用 测试 系统 方法 | ||
本申请提供了一种支付标记化应用的测试系统,包括:银行系统和银联系统,其中,所述银联系统在本地模拟得到;所述银行系统,用于接收所述支付标记化应用发送的第一测试请求,并向所述银联系统发送所述第一测试请求,所述银联系统,用于响应于所述第一测试请求,对所述测试请求中的数据进行处理,得到第一处理结果,并向所述支付标记化应用返回所述第一处理结果。如此,避免了与外部系统协调,提高了测试效率,降低了测试成本。
技术领域
本申请涉及计算机技术领域,尤其涉及一种支付标记化应用的测试系统及方法。
背景技术
随着用户对交易安全的需求的提高,支付标记化技术也应运而生。该技术主要是通过支付标记(token)代替银行卡号进行交易验证,从而避免银行卡号信息泄露带来的风险。
支付标记化是使用一个支付标记,通常是一个唯一的数值来替代传统的银行卡主账号,同时确保该数值的应用被限定在一个特定的商户、渠道或设备。支付标记可以运用在银行卡交易的各个环节,与现有基于银行卡号的交易一样,可以在产业中跨行使用,具有通用性。
当前,越来越多的应用支持支付标记化,支持支付标记化的应用可以称之为支付标记化应用。这种支付标记化应用在上线前进行测试时,需要外部系统协调,如银联、商户等等。如此,增加了不可控因素,影响了测试效率。
发明内容
本申请提供了一种支付标记化应用的测试系统,该系统通过在本地模拟外部系统,由模拟的外部系统代替真实外部系统参与支付标记化应用的测试流程,避免了与真实外部系统协调环节,减少了不可控因素,提高了测试效率。
第一方面,本申请提供了一种支付标记化应用的测试系统,所述系统包括:银行系统和银联系统,其中,所述银联系统在本地模拟得到;
所述银行系统,用于接收所述支付标记化应用发送的第一测试请求,并向所述银联系统发送所述第一测试请求;
所述银联系统,用于响应于所述第一测试请求,对所述测试请求中的数据进行处理,得到第一处理结果,并向所述支付标记化应用返回所述第一处理结果。
在一些可能的实现方式中,所述第一测试请求用于对支付标记申请流程进行测试,所述第一测试请求中包括业务的授权信息;
所述第一处理结果包括一级支付标记以及与所述授权信息对应的授权密文。
在一些可能的实现方式中,所述系统还包括商户系统,所述商户系统在本地模拟得到;
所述商户系统,用于接收所述支付标记化应用发送的第二测试请求,所述第二测试请求包括所述第一处理结果;
所述商户系统,还用于根据所述第一处理结果,从所述银联系统获取目标数据,然后向所述支付标记化应用返回第二处理结果。
在一些可能的实现方式中,所述第二测试请求包括业务的授权信息对应的授权密文;
所述目标数据包括二级支付标记;
所述第二处理结果包括支付标记申请结果。
在一些可能的实现方式中,所述支付标记化应用包括手机银行。
第二方面,本申请提供了一种支付标记化应用的测试方法。该方法应用于支付标记化应用的测试系统,所述系统包括:银行系统和银联系统,其中,所述银联系统在本地模拟得到。所述方法包括:
所述银行系统接收所述支付标记化应用发送的第一测试请求,并向所述银联系统发送所述第一测试请求;
所述银联系统响应于所述第一测试请求,对所述测试请求中的数据进行处理,得到第一处理结果,并向所述支付标记化应用返回所述第一处理结果。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国银行股份有限公司,未经中国银行股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010343596.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:数据推送方法、装置及系统
- 下一篇:可穿戴激光疼痛治疗装置